Transaction 059d69e36e88e9aa2da8b84b07268f218876eb43b5fdd46cf57bca0040435400

2 Input
2 Outputs
  • 059d69e36e88e9aa2da8b84b07268f218876eb43b5fdd46cf57bca0040435400:0
  • value  25918468
    address  3BBjqFaUk3m8t28PnGVTJ2P1FjDUCu2TxJ
  • 059d69e36e88e9aa2da8b84b07268f218876eb43b5fdd46cf57bca0040435400:1
  • value  2510536
    address  34rQ2iEgPeKQSx5UmgRsbs6pxaWvBoTjs5